You are on page 1of 4

INSTITUTO SUPERIOR TECNOLGICO PBLICO DE HUARMEY CARRERA PROFESIONAL: COMPUTACIN E INFORMATICA

SILABO
I INFORMACIN GENERAL:
1.1 1.2 1.3 1.4 1.5 1.6 Diseo y Construccin de Software Base de datos - Implementacin y administracin V 2009 - I 17 Semanas Inicio: 30 de marzo de 2009 Trmino: 31 de julio de 2009 1.7 Hora semanal Total : Semanal : 05 Horas Teora : 02 Horas Prctica : 03 Horas Semestral : 85 Horas 1.8 DOCENTE RESPONSABLE : Ing. Jos Alberto CASTRO CURAY e_mail : castrojacc@hotmail.com Celular : 943549485 Modulo Unidades Didctica Semestre Ao Acadmico Duracin Fecha : : : : : :

II

FUNDAMENTACIN:
La presente unidad didctica, Base de datos - Implementacin y administracin, es la base principal y fundamental en el desarrollo tcnico y profesional del estudiante de la Carrera Profesional de Computacin e Informtica, por que le permite crear, desarrollar, implementar y administrar base de datos para obtener informacin optima y precisa para la toma de decisiones de las organizaciones de nuestra comunidad. Tiene por finalidad proporcionar al estudiante todo el fundamento bsico y necesario para la implementacin, desarrollo y administracin de la base de datos de un sistema de tipo transaccional la cual permitir realizar consultas y poseer informacin precisa en el momento oportuno para la toma de decisiones.

III COMPETENCIA MODULAR


Implementar sistemas informticos, de acuerdo a los requerimientos de la organizacin; considerando los criterios de seguridad en la transmisin y el almacenamiento de datos.

IV

CAPACIDAD TERMINAL DE UNIDAD DIDACTICA:


Desarrollar, implementar y administrar una base de datos, basado en el modelo de datos relacional utilizando el sistema administrador de base de datos

MySQL y el Lenguaje Estructurado de Consulta SQL, actuando con valores y principios en los datos de la empresa o institucin.

CONTENIDOS DE UNIDAD DIDACTICA:


SEMANA CONTENIDO TEORICO Fundamentos de Implementacin y Administracin de base de datos Integracin del modelo relacional lgico y fsico de una base de datos Mantenimiento de datos de la base de datos Tipos de Datos en MySQL Tipos de Sentencias SQL en MySQL CONTENIDO PRACTICO Instalacin y configuracin de MySQL. Creacin de base de datos en MySQL y sincronizacin con el modelamiento lgico DBDesigner Actualizacin y mantenimiento de datos de la base de datos en el modelo lgico y fsica Equivalencia de datos del modelo lgico y fsico de una base de datos Creacin de tablas: estructura, tipo, campos, clave primaria, clave fornea, ndices. Consulta simples y complejas a tablas de una base de datos Consultas utilizando operadores de una o varias tablas Consultas utilizando las funciones que soporta MySQL Uso de los procedimientos almacenados en MySQL Uso de los triggers y vistas en MySQL Seguridad de una base de datos Manejo de software de herramienta administrativas para MySQL

Semana N 01 Semana N 02

Semana N 03 Semana N 04 Semana N 05 Semana N 06 Semana N 07 Semana N 08 Semana N 09 Semana N 10 Semana N 11 Semana Semana Semana Semana Semana Semana N N N N N N 12 13 14 15 16 17

Operadores de base de datos Funciones: de control de flujo, de cadena, comparacin, matemticas, fecha, bsqueda, grupos, Procedimientos almacenados y funciones Triggers y vistas Usuarios y privilegios Herramienta Administrativa: Query Browser Herramienta Administrativa: Maestro Conexin ODBC para MySQL

MySQL MySQL

VI

ESTRATEGIAS METODOLGICAS:
La estrategia metodolgica a seguir ser participativa donde el docente ser el facilitador del conocimiento, utilizando los mtodos participativos; el cual ser aplicado y puesto en prctica en el laboratorio de cmputo.

VII EVALUACIN:
La evaluacin del aprendizaje es permanente y vigesimal, siendo la nota

mnima aprobatoria de 13 (Trece) en cada una de las unidades didcticas. En todos los casos la fraccin 0,5 o ms se considera como una unidad a favor del estudiante. El estudiante que en la evaluacin de una o ms capacidades terminales programadas en la U.D. obtenga una nota desaprobatoria entre 10 (diez) y 12(doce), tiene derecho a participar en el proceso de recuperacin. El

estudiante que obtenga nota menor a 10 (diez), no podr asistir al proceso de recuperacin, por lo tanto repetir la U.D. El proceso de recuperacin tiene carcter obligatorio y debe comprender acciones como trabajos prcticos, actividades de autoaprendizaje y otras acciones formativas que el docente considere conveniente, las mismas que deben estar relacionadas con las capacidades terminales en las cuales obtuvo promedio desaprobatorio. El estudiante que acumulara inasistencias injustificadas igual o mayor al 30% del total de horas programadas en la U.D., ser desaprobado en forma automtica.

VIII BIBLIOGRAFIA:
Eddy Blaider Aburto Correa y Robert Jaime Pantigoso Silva. Base de Datos con SQL Server 2000. 1era edicin. Setiembre 2001.

Joel de la Cruz Villar. Php 5 & MySQL 5.1era Edicin Marzo 2006 Joyanes Aguilar, Luis.(1999). Introduccin a la teora de ficheros. Manuales de ERwin. Curso Titulacin Universidad Privada San Pedro. Maribel Sabana Mendoza. Modelamiento e implementacin de Base de Datos.

WEB SITE:
http://www.monografias.com http://www.lawebdelprogramador.com http://www.aulaclic.com http://www.areainteractiva.com http://www.elprisma.com

IX PROGRAMACIN DE LA UNIDAD DIDCTICA


MODULO: Diseo y Construccin de Software UNIDAD DIDCTICA: Base de datos - Implementacin y administracin CAPACIDAD TERMINAL : Desarrollar, implementar y administrar una base de datos, basado en el modelo de datos relacional utilizando el sistema administrador de base de datos MySQL y el Lenguaje Estructurado de Consulta SQL, actuando con valores y principios en los datos de la empresa o institucin.
ELEMENTOS DE LA CAPACIDAD CONCEPTOS PROCEDIMIENTOS CONCEPTOS ACTITUDES Participa activamente en las sesiones de clases para crear e implementar una base de datos, trabajando con responsabilidad y criterio personal. Sabe crear una base de Fundamentos de Implementacin y datos en MSQL y Administracin de base de datos sincronizarla con su Integracin del modelo relacional modelamiento lgico. lgico y fsico de una base de datos Mantenimiento de datos de la base de Conoce y sigue la datos sintaxis para utilizar las Tipos de Datos en MySQL sentencias de SQL en Tipos de Sentencias SQL en MySQL MSQL. Utiliza las funciones de MySQL y crea procedimientos, triggers y vistas para la administracin de la informacin de la base de datos. Torga privilegios a los diferentes niveles de usuarios. Operadores de base de datos ACTIVIDADES DE APRENDIZAJE Implementacin de una base de datos CRITERIOS DE EVALUACIN Es capaz de crear base de datos y darle la actualizacin respectiva a los datos HORAS

Implementa una base de datos fsica utilizando para ello el Administrador de base de datos MySQL

15 horas

Sentencias de SQL en MySQL Participa activamente en las sesiones de clases de Administracin de base de datos y seguridad de la misma, con responsabilidad y criterio personal Operadores funciones MySQL y en Es capaz de realizar consultas en una base de datos, teniendo en cuenta privilegios de cada usuario.

15 horas

Administra la informacin almacenada en una base de datos a travs de las funciones, procedimientos y Triggers, otorgando privilegios a cada nivel de usuario. Utiliza las herramientas existentes para la administracin de una base de datos en MySQL

Funciones:

de control de flujo, de cadena, comparacin, matemticas, fecha, bsqueda, grupos, Procedimientos almacenados y funciones Triggers y vistas Usuarios y privilegios

15 horas

Administracin y seguridad de una base de datos

15 horas

Conoce y utiliza las Herramienta Administrativa: MySQL herramientas para Query Browser administrar base de Herramienta Administrativa: MySQL datos en MySQL Maestro Conexin ODBC para MySQL

Participa activamente en las sesiones de clases de manejo de herramientas administrativas con criterio personal

Herramientas Administrativas de MySQL

Es capaz de utilizar las herramientas administrativas de MySQL en la implementacin y administracin de una base de datos.

25 horas

Huarmey, 30 de marzo de 2009